NHTSA Complaint Number: 004305015 Incident Date: Oct, 19 2004
Consumer's City: REPTON Consumer's State: AL
Vehicle Transmission Type: AUTO Manufacturers Name: Ford Motor Company
Model Name: EXPLORER Model Year: 1994
Vehicle Involved in a Crash: No Component's Description: Electrical system:wiring:fuses and circuit breakers
Vehicle Involved in a Fire: No Persons Injured: 0
Vehicle's VIN#: 1FMCU22XXRU Date added to File: May, 25 2021
Date Complaint Received: Oct, 25 2004 Complaint Type: IVOQ
Incident Reported To Police: No Purchase Date: Jul, 31 2001
Was Original Owner: No Anti-lock Brakes: No
Number of Cylinders: 6 Date of Manufacturer: -
Was Vehicle Towed: - Description of the Complaints: 1994 explorer 4.0 v6 automatic transmission rebiult 3 times in past year .countless times vehicle has stalled acting as if the fuel pump quit, fuel pump replaced, coil packs replaced, relays replaced. once on the highway at 70 mph, another time while pulling into traffic. usually upon start up. air conditioner switch shorted out, saw burned wires on switch upon replacement. antifreeze spewed out from side of motor, assumed to be around heads but has not been to shop yet.*ak
